Tommy BISHOP Obituary

BISHOP, Tommy Roger Tommy Roger Bishop, age 86, was born on September 10, 1930, and passed away on September 7, 2017. Tom is survived by his sister, Kathy; and sons Mike and Jim. No services will be held. Condolences may be left at www.cookwaldenforestoaks.com
